Rental market highlights
As of May 2026, the average rent in Beverly, MA is $2,600 per month, which is 36% higher than the national average rent of $1,910 per month.

As of May 2026, apartments are the most affordable rental option in Beverly, MA at $2,778 per month, while townhomes are the most expensive at $3,250 per month. Houses average $3,000 per month, offering a mid-range alternative for renters.
Average rent by number of bedrooms
| Floor plan type | Average rent |
|---|---|
| 1 Bedroom | $2,200 |
| 2 Bedrooms | $2,700 |
| 3 Bedrooms | $3,200 |
| 4 Bedrooms | $3,850 |
| All | $2,600 |
As of May 2026, the average rent for a 1 bedroom rental in Beverly, MA is $2,200 per month, followed by $2,700 for a 2 bedroom rental, $3,200 for a 3 bedroom rental, and $3,850 for a 4 bedroom rental.
